The legacy bot polled the deploy API every minute; the replacement subscribes to pipeline events directly, so status messages arrive within seconds and the old polling credentials can be retired. Before enabling the subscription, confirm the channel routing map: each team room must map to exactly one pipeline group, or messages will double-post. New team members should run the dry-run mode first and compare output against the legacy bot. The bot reads the following configuration at startup.

config for kafof-bawef:
holath:
  log_level: debug
  metrics_host: metrics.holath.qorvelsys.internal
  pin: 2191
  pool_size: 32

Ticket: Staging env misconfigured for Siftgate bloom filter

The bloom layer in front of the Pellet KV store is rejecting all lookups in staging because the env file was copied from the dev template without credentials. False-positive tuning values are fine; only the auth line is missing. To unblock the weekly demo, the Pellet admission secret must be set on the following line.

env line for yaguf-fajop: LEDGER_TOKEN13=fb08984397349

== Transport: Recalled Charger Pallet ==

Receiving sites handling the Voltarra charger recall should expect one shrink-wrapped pallet per batch, tagged RECALL-ORANGE. Units are potentially defective; do not plug in, do not break the wrap. Count cartons against the manifest and note any damage on the receipt copy. The pallet moves onward to the disposal contractor within 48 hours. Before releasing it to the contractor's courier, state the confirmation phrase that appears below.

handover note for yagef-bagep: the drudor pelius courier leaves the kasdor zorvan norir ledger at gate 8016 under passcode 755406

Welcome to the Tansywick platform team. The read-replica lag alarm (service name: replag-watch) is deployed only from signed artifacts. Every build produced by our Coppermill CI runner is signed before it reaches the staging registry, and the deploy gate at Harrowgate refuses anything unsigned. When you set up a local verification environment, import the team signing identity into your keyring first, then run the verify script against the latest tarball. For convenience, the current signing key is provided directly below.

release key, fajef-kajeg: bky19_LdLu6Ne6FLi8he2c24d